They built my friends driveshaft for his ls1 swap into rx7. I also had them rebuild a driveshaft for my previous rx7,( similar driveshaft to e30s with non-serviceable u-joints). They can hook you up with a new csb and guibo if needed.
Thanks. Roughly what should I expect to pay if I bring them a bare driveshaft for rebuilt u-joints?
depends what you need. I vaguely remember calling them about a e30 drive shaft. new ujoints, csb, and guibo was about 300. so If you just need u-joints im going to say in the neighborhood of 150-200. you have to remember the u-joints are non-serviceable so they gotta do some work.
